#0be210 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0be210 is composed of 4.3% red, 88.6%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.9%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 121.4 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 46.5%. #0be210 color hex could be obtained by blending #16ff20 with #00c500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

Shades and Tints of #0be210
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000200 is the darkest color, while #eefeee is the lightest one.

Tones of #0be210
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f7e70 is the less saturated color, while #02eb07 is the most saturated one.
